I'm considering going to the DCC in January but a friend of mine mentioned that the weather in Elizabeth, IN is terribly that time of year. Snowy, windy and freezing. Can anyone confirm this?
That's certainly not true every year. I have been to the DCC in shorts before. Weather near Louisville is a roll of the dice that time of year. The average high for Feb is 48ºF and average low is 30ºF.
